A precision wheel alignment helps your car drive straight, improves fuel efficiency, and extends the life of your tires. Misalignment can cause your vehicle to drift and create uneven wear patterns. Scheduling regular alignments will save you money on tires and keep your vehicle handling at its best. Even small alignment problems can create big issues over time.
Whether you picked up a nail or notice a sudden drop in tire pressure, our tire repair service can save you money and extend the life of your tires. In many cases, a repair is faster and more cost-effective than replacing the tire entirely.
Balancing your tires ensures even wear and reduces vibrations while driving. Every time we install new tires, we balance them perfectly. If you frequently drive on rough roads, we recommend having your tires rebalanced or rotated every 4,000 to 6,000 miles. This will help your tires wear evenly and last longer.
